As everyone in the brewing industry knows, yeast is the engine that drives a brewery. In this presentation, John Giarratano of Inland Island Yeast Laboratories will dive into practical knowledge and standard practices for the introduction and management of yeast in a brewery. From pitch rate to multi-generational yeast health, John will discuss practices that every brewer can take back work and improve beer quality and brewery performance.


John Giarratano founded Inland Island back in 2014 and continues to lead the company in customer service and innovation. John’s previous career in pharmaceutical GMP manufacturing and bio fuels introduced him to the world of yeast propagation, and he saw the need for a local yeast lab in Colorado. What started as selling vials of yeast to homebrewing shops quickly blossomed into an industry leading yeast laboratory supplying breweries large and small from coast to coast and beyond. Many breweries are too small to have their own labs, so John’s team provides them with the quality control and care that they would not have access to otherwise. John’s proud of the niche he and his team have carved in the industry and believes that yeast is the single most important ingredient in beer! In his spare time John volunteers his time with the Master Brewers Association of the Americas and strives to educate the brewing community and public alike on yeast management and brewing practices.
